COWLES FOUNDATION DISCUSSION PAPER NO. 1532R

Information in Mechanism Design

Dirk Bergemann
Department of Economics, Yale University

Juuso Välimäki
Department of Economics, Helsinki School of Economics and University of Southampton

 Revised January 2006

We survey the recent literature on the role of information in mechanism design. First, we discuss an emerging literature on the role of endogenous payoff and strategic information for the design and the efficiency of the mechanism. We specifically consider information management in the form of acquisition of new information or disclosure of existing information. Second, we argue that in the presence of endogenous information, the robustness of the mechanism to the type space and higher order beliefs becomes a natural desideratum. We discuss recent approaches to robust mechanism design and robust implementation.

Keywords: Mechanism Design, Information Acquisition, Ex Post Equilibrium, Robust Mechanism Design, Interdependent Values, Information Management

JEL Classification: C79, D82
